Serious Motorcycle collision Injures Three on Route MM Near Camden County, MO
Camden Co, MO (September 15, 2025) – A head-on motorcycle collision on Route MM, approximately 1,335 feet west of Shawnee Four Dr, resulted in serious injuries too three individuals Saturday afternoon. The Missouri State Highway Patrol Troop F responded to the scene at approximately 3:52 p.m.
Preliminary investigations indicate a 2014 Harley Davidson FLHXS, traveling westbound, crossed the center line while in a curve and collided with an eastbound 2009 Harley Davidson Electra Glide Ultra Classic. Both motorcycles sustained significant damage and required towing from the location by Grand Towing.
The rider of the 2014 Harley Davidson, a 45-year-old male from Sioux Falls, SD, sustained serious injuries. He was not wearing a helmet at the time of the accident and was airlifted by MU Air Care to University Hospital for treatment.
The driver of the 2009 Harley Davidson, a 47-year-old man from Washington, MO, suffered moderate injuries and was transported by Lake Ozark Ambulance to Lake Regional Hospital. A passenger on the Electra Glide, a 44-year-old female also from Washington, MO, sustained serious injuries and was transported by Lake West Ambulance to Lake Regional Hospital.
Personnel from the Sunrise Beach Fire Department assisted at the crash site, alongside missouri State Highway Patrol troopers including cpl. M. R. Parker, Cpl. J. P. Lewis, tpr. S. W.Mahaney, Tpr. J. C. Simpson,and tpr.J. K. Rizer.
